In this article, we will be exploring how to install multiple packages simultaneously in Ubuntu using the Advanced Packaging Tool (APT). This is a common task for system administrators and developers who often need to install several packages at once to set up a system or environment.
To install multiple packages at the same time in Ubuntu using APT, you can use the
apt-get install command followed by the names of the packages, each separated by a space. You can also automate the process by creating a text file with the list of packages and using
xargs to install them all at once.
Introduction to APT
APT, short for Advanced Packaging Tool, is a powerful, free software user interface that works with core libraries to handle the installation and removal of software on the Debian, Ubuntu, and other Linux distributions. It simplifies the process of managing software on Unix-like computer systems by automating the retrieval, configuration, and installation of software packages.
Installing Multiple Packages
To install multiple packages at the same time, you can use the
apt-get install command followed by the names of the packages, each separated by a space. Here is the general syntax:
sudo apt-get install package1 package2 package3
In this command:
sudois a command that allows users to run programs with the security privileges of the superuser or root. It’s necessary to use
sudobecause installing software on a Linux system typically requires root privileges.
apt-getis the APT package handling utility (CLI), particularly useful for installing packages.
installis the command that tells APT to install the specified packages.
package1 package2 package3are the names of the packages you want to install. You can list as many packages as you need.
For example, if you want to install
curl, you would use the following command:
sudo apt-get install nano wget curl
Automating the Process
If you have a long list of packages to install, it might be more efficient to store them in a text file and then use
xargs to install all of them at once. Here’s how you can do it:
- Create a text file and list all the packages you want to install, each on a new line.
- Save the file (for example, as
- Use the following command to install all the packages listed in the file:
cat packages.txt | xargs sudo apt-get install
In this command,
cat packages.txt reads the file, and
xargs sudo apt-get install takes the output and passes it as arguments to
sudo apt-get install.
By using APT, you can easily install multiple packages at the same time on Ubuntu and other Debian-based systems. This can save you a lot of time and help you automate your setup process. Remember to use
sudo to ensure you have the necessary permissions, and always check the list of packages being installed to avoid any potential issues.
For more information about APT and its capabilities, you can check the APT User’s Guide or use the
man apt command to access the manual directly from your terminal.
Yes, you can install multiple packages at the same time in Ubuntu using APT. You can use the
apt-get install command followed by the names of the packages, each separated by a space.
Yes, installing software on a Linux system typically requires root privileges. You can use the
sudo command before the
apt-get install command to run it with root privileges.
Yes, you can automate the installation of multiple packages. You can store the list of packages in a text file and then use the
xargs command to install all of them at once.